What value does my life bring to this world? Am I accomplishing anything meaningful? Struggling with the sin inside, living in a self-centered society, it’s way too easy for us to go through life accomplishing little of lasting value. When Jesus is the Lord of my life, that all changes.

A Thought to Ponder: The One who made our hearts is the only One who can truly mend them. What fresh perspective has God given you today about your purpose in life?
A Treasure to Share: “Whatever you do, work at it with all your heart, as working for the Lord, not for men, since you know that you will receive an inheritance from the Lord as a reward. It is the Lord Christ you are serving” (Colossians 3:23-24).
A Challenge for the Week: “Return home and tell how much God has done for you” (Luke 8:39). This challenges implies two things: 1) Describe in your own words what Jesus has done for you. 2) Actively share your story with others where you live, where you work, or where you go to school so that they can learn what Jesus has done for them too. Consider: The restored man from Luke 8:26-39 may have had a limited theological education, but what he lacked in theological knowledge was replaced by the personal experience of his contact with Jesus.
